首页> 中文学位 >端子功能可配置ATE通讯资源模块研制
【6h】

端子功能可配置ATE通讯资源模块研制

代理获取

目录

封面

中文摘要

英文摘要

目录

第1章 绪 论

1.1 课题背景、目的及意义

1.2 国内外研究现状

1.3 课题主要研究内容

1.4 本文结构

第2章 总体方案

2.1 功能要求及技术指标

2.2 总体设计方案

2.3 本章小结

第3章 硬件设计

3.1 端子功能可配置设计

3.2 多种通讯类型功能设计

3.3 大容量数据存储单元设计

3.4 主处理选择及配置

3.5 总线接口选择及配置

3.6 FPGA类型选择

3.7 本章小结

第4章 软件设计

4.1 DSP固化软件设计

4.2 驱动函数设计

4.3 上位机软面板设计

4.4 本章小结

第5章 测试验证

5.1 测试环境搭建

5.2 测试内容

5.3 本章小结

结论

参考文献

附录

攻读硕士学位期间发表的论文及其它成果

声明

致谢

展开▼

摘要

实现通用化和小型化已成为自动测试设备发展的重要趋势,目前已有的测试设备主要采取通用的测试仪器资源和专用的接口适配器(TUA)实现其通用化。随着被测武器设备型号的日益增加,专用测试接口适配器的数量也越来越多,以致整个测试设备体积过于庞大。为了解决这个问题,本文研制了一种端子功能可配置通讯资源模块,通过端子配置功能,替代TUA分配能力,同时,与超宽测量范围的端子功能可配置仪器资源配合使用,达到取消TUA的目的,实现自动测试设备的完全通用化。研制该模块具有重要的应用价值。
  本模块在3U标准尺寸CPCI板卡上集成了12路RS422、2路RS232、4路RS485、4路ARINC429、2路CAN功能可切换的通讯通道和1路独立的1553B通道。其中,每个通道可以在基本的RS422和其它一种通信功能之间通过软件进行切换。硬件设计上采用DSP+FPGA的结构,DSP使用高性能的DM642,其主频高达720MHz,主要完成命令解析执行、功能配置、复杂数据管理、数据交互等功能;其内嵌 PCI接口单元,可以方便地实现高可靠性的CPCI接口功能。在FPGA内部实现了RS422/RS232通讯逻辑、ARINC429通讯逻辑、1553B通讯逻辑、RS485通讯逻辑和CAN控制逻辑,以及时钟和复位逻辑。利用FPGA内部的硬核控制器实现对大容量的数据缓存控制,同时设计了总线时序转换逻辑,以便DSP可以实现对DDR2的直接管理与操控。在功能电路上,实现了所有通讯资源的隔离电路设计和独立的1553接口电路设计。
  模块软件包括DSP固化软件和上位机软件。DSP固化软件包括命令解析函数、功能配置函数、复杂数据管理函数和数据交互函数。通过上位机软件进行每个通道通讯模式配置,并在不同配置模式下进行相应的通讯波特率和控制字设置,以及在各通讯类型相关函数的配合使用下,实现数据收发。对于多通道并行数据处理,采用定时读取外部存储器方式,接收多通道并行通讯数据。同时,为了完成对模块中的各个功能块的调试和验证,设计了专用的上位机测试软面板。
  最后,对模块进行测试并在新一代测试系统中验证。测试和验证结果证明,本模块设计合理,运行稳定,各项指标满足要求。

著录项

相似文献

  • 中文文献
  • 外文文献
  • 专利
代理获取

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号